DJB Instruments designs and manufactures a comprehensive range of piezoelectric accelerometers for vibration measurement in the most demanding environments. Available in both charge output and IEPE (voltage output) configurations, our sensors are trusted across automotive, aerospace, industrial and research applications worldwide.
From ultra-miniature and low-mass sensors to triaxial, high-shock and ultra-high-temperature accelerometers, every DJB product is built around our proprietary Konic Shear® sensing technology to deliver reliable, repeatable data with minimal cross-axis and thermal effects.

The science behind KONIC Shear accelerometers
DJB’s innovative KONIC Shear design delivers superior accuracy, durability, and resistance to environmental influences, making it one of the most robust accelerometers on the market.
This advanced design minimises the impact of thermal transients and base strain, ensuring highly reliable vibration measurements in demanding conditions.
